A course that covers the integrated approach and interrelationship among the functional areas of business as well as sensitivity to the economic, social, technological, legal, and international environment in which business must operate. The social responsibility and good governance are inter-linked that aim to give protection to the interests of the stakeholders so that they can get benefited from the decision-making processes of existing entities especially corporations.
It focuses on the development of good governance as a way of measuring how public institutions conduct public affairs and manage public resources in a preferred way. The concept of "good governance" thus emerges as a model to compare ineffective economies or political bodies with viable economies and political bodies.
At the end of the semester, this course should instill business knowledge and develop qualities of the students that are essential to organizational success. Good governance is at the heart of any successful business. It is essential for a company or organization to achieve its objectives and drive improvement, as well as maintain legal and ethical standing in the eyes of shareholders, regulators, and the wider community.

This course designed to provide students with the natural and social science concepts that are taught in the Early Childhood and Elementary classroom settings as well as the various teaching methodologies for the teaching of these concepts. Students will develop lessons in the content area of social studies and have the opportunity for the evaluation of these lessons. The social studies methods segment of this course will focus on the relevance of history and geography, the study of people, and the interaction of people with others and the world around them. Strategies for engaging and empowering young learners to become active, democratic citizens will also be presented.

The course covers a range of major issues impacting human resource management in organizations including demographic and social change, ethics in HRM, managing diversity, assessment center techniques, the impact of Government legislation on HRM, the contribution of HRM to improving productivity, managing outsourcing, career development and mentoring.

This course covers range of major issues impacting marketing management in organizations including customer experience management, customer satisfaction management, innovation in the retail business, and the like.
